DEEDED AS TWO SEPARATELY DEEDED 3-FAMILY PARCELS, this immaculate six-unit apartment building was gut renovated in 2018 and is presented as a turnkey offering. Interiors have been updated throughout, with each unit designed to include stainless steel appliances, granite countertops, central air/heat, hardwood floors, and recessed lighting. Additional unit features include private rear decks. The building also includes high-efficiency tankless water heaters along with fully updated plumbing and electrical systems.
The property is located at 39–41 W. Walnut Park in Boston, MA 02119 and is positioned near the Stony Brook Orange Line, Sam Adams Brewery, and the Southwest Corridor Park & Bike Path. It is also close to the Longwood Medical Area and Northeastern University, as well as the Back Bay.

NOI Build-Up
- Vacancy
- income lost from leasable area expected to sit empty during the year — subtracted from gross rent.
- EGI (Effective Gross Income)
- gross rent minus vacancy losses — the realistic income before paying operating costs.
- OpEx (Operating Expenses)
- recurring costs to operate the property (property tax, insurance, utilities, maintenance, management) — excludes financing and capital improvements.
- NOI (Net Operating Income)
- income a property generates after operating costs but before financing and taxes.
